Manufacturing Process
1. Product Design & Development
The drip tray dimensions, collection depth, wall profile, raised edges, mounting arrangement, removal method, and available appliance space are reviewed during product development. CAD drawings, technical specifications, or physical samples can be used to establish the required design.
2. Plastic Mould Design
The injection mould is designed according to the tray geometry and selected material. Cavity layout, parting line, draft angles, gate location, cooling arrangement, ejection system, wall thickness, and shrinkage considerations are evaluated to support consistent moulding.
3. Mould Manufacturing
The mould is manufactured using suitable mould steel such as P20 Steel, H13 Steel, or S136 Steel according to the required production volume, mould life, material characteristics, dimensional requirements, and surface-finish expectations.
4. Injection Moulding
The selected plastic material is heated and injected into the mould cavity under controlled processing conditions. Filling, packing, cooling, and ejection parameters are managed to achieve the required tray dimensions, shape, and surface quality.
5. Finishing & Assembly Preparation
After moulding, runners or gates are removed where required. The tray is visually inspected and prepared for fitment with the popcorn maker assembly. Any required secondary operations are performed according to the approved product design.
6. Quality Inspection
Finished drip trays are inspected for dimensions, collection cavity geometry, wall consistency, mounting features, surface quality, fitment, and overall production consistency.
Raw Materials
| Material | Typical Application |
|---|---|
| PP | Lightweight trays with suitable moisture and chemical resistance |
| High-Temperature PP | Applications requiring improved temperature capability |
| HDPE | Durable collection tray applications with suitable chemical resistance |
| ABS | Rigid trays where appearance and structural characteristics are important |
| HIPS | Economical rigid appliance component applications |
| PBT | Applications requiring improved dimensional and thermal stability |
| Heat-Resistant Engineering Plastic | Applications exposed to elevated temperatures, subject to actual operating conditions |
| Food-Contact Grade Plastic | Applications where the tray may come into direct or indirect food-related contact, subject to applicable requirements |
Material selection should be finalized according to the actual temperature exposure, contact with hot oil or moisture, cleaning conditions, mechanical loading, proximity to heating elements, and food-contact requirements. General-purpose plastic should not automatically be assumed suitable for direct contact with hot food or high-temperature residues.
Quality Control
Raw Material Inspection: Material grade, colour, and incoming material condition are checked.
Mould Inspection: Cavity surfaces, parting line, cooling system, ejection mechanism, and critical mould features are inspected.
Dimensional Inspection: Overall length, width, height, depth, wall sections, and critical dimensions are verified.
Cavity & Edge Inspection: Collection cavity, raised edges, corners, and drainage or retention features are checked.
Mounting Inspection: Locating tabs, clips, slots, screw points, or other fixing features are verified.
Visual Inspection: Surface finish, colour consistency, flash, sink marks, warpage, scratches, and other visible defects are reviewed.
Fitment Inspection: The tray is checked against the corresponding popcorn maker housing or collection area.
Functional Inspection: Tray insertion, removal, retention, and collection function are evaluated where applicable.
Application Validation: Temperature, moisture, oil, cleaning, mechanical, and food-contact suitability are evaluated according to the final application.
Packaging Inspection: Finished trays are packed to reduce scratches, deformation, and handling damage during transportation.
